Afternoon!

Just wonderinf if anyone has had problems with Yealink W60/W56 DECT phones not showing the correct time on the handset display?

I have set the timezone in the extension/phone config on 3CX and checked this is filtering through to the phone's web page config but still 8 hours out!

Hi guys

Thanks for taking the time, sorry for the delayed response.

JohnS, yes this is a W60B base with 3 x W56H handsets connected. Straight out of the box they all have the wrong time set which is understandable. When setting up the base in 3CX I set the correct time zone but it doesn't help.

I also went into the web gui for the base and checked it had taken effect in there which it had.

The firmware is 77.83.0.25.

This is happening for two seperate instances. In each case, all other phones are working fine and pulling the time correctly.

When I attempt to set the time manually using the W56H menu it doesn't take effect. I have logged a ticket with Yealink but they are closed for the Chinese new year!

Can anyone clarify exactly how the time process works for DECT handsets? Am I right in thinking that they pull time from the base? Is there a way to check what time the W60B base has at the moment? I searched its web gui but couldn't find a reading of the current time.

Go here https://www.yealink.com/products_48.html

Click "Software" button on top of page, download correct 3CX firmware for this model so we can be aligned on the same version. Factory reset and reprovision the device.

If your PBX is hosted on a windows machine, ensure it also has the correct time zone (important)

JohnS thanks for the help mate this resolved my issue.

I downgraded the W60P base firmware from 77.83.0.25 to 77.83.0.20 as listed on that webpage you linked. As soon as the base had rebooted the time was immediately corrected on all handsets. I didn't need to factory reset or reprovision. I then went to the other client site's which had W60P's and the same process fixed those also.

It appears firmware 77.83.0.25 is fudged. (For lack of a better technical term)

I would recommend doing a rest/reprovision anyway if you can, just to make sure there is no chance that any funky settings from the previous firmware stays behind possibly corrupting the operation of the device. Usually the upgrade process takes care of this (I hope) but for downgrading I'm not so sure.
